GENERAL INFORMATION: This year's competition is about technical roasting and blending skills. Can you create the best roast for brewing from a single coffee that is the same for all competitors? Can you create the best high end espresso blend from a pair of coffees that is the same for all competitors? Since everyone is using the same coffees; mistakes and flaws will stick out. So the winner must produce a technically perfect roast, as well as one that hits the sweet spot of these coffees.
There are no naturals in the mix, so dramatic day to day changes in the taste are less likely. However, do be aware how your coffee ages and arrange the shipping and freezing accordingly.

FORMAT There is only one espresso and one brewed competition this year.
- Espresso: a 3rd wave blend of a pulp natural Brazil Yellow Bourbon and an Antigua Bourbon. You may submit 100% of one or the other coffee as your entry. Blends with multiple roasts and roast levels (melange blends) are allowed
- Brewed: a high end brewing coffee from a single Kenya Nyeri. Blends of multiple roasts and roast levels (melange blends) are allowed.
- Espresso 1: Guatemala Antigua Finca Retena
- Espresso 2: Brazil (Carmo de Minas) Fazenda Sao Benedito Pulp Natural.
- Brewing: Kenya Nyeri Gaturiri AB

PACKAGING
- Packaging must be ready for the freezer
- It must be robustly labeled with your name, email or HB handle, and what it is entered for.
- You can include notes on paper about the blend and roast, or submit these by email/pm
- We need a minimum 1/4 pound of green roasted (net weight 90 to 95 grams).
- There is no need to send more than a half pound.
